Taxonomy
Alphadon halleyi was named by Sahni (1972) [type is a left m1]. Its type specimen is AMNH 77367, a tooth (m1), and it is not a trace fossil. Its type locality is Clambank Hollow Quarry, which is in a Campanian/Campanian fine channel fill claystone in the Judith River Formation of Montana.
